位置:泸州炬业科技-炬业问答 > 资讯中心 > 知识解读 > 文章详情

starccm运行进程名称是什么

作者:泸州炬业科技-炬业问答
|
32人看过
发布时间:2026-05-24 11:36:35
星际流体动力学模拟器:StarCCM+ 的运行进程名称揭秘在工程仿真领域,StarCCM+ 是一款备受推崇的流体动力学模拟软件,广泛应用于航空航天、能源、汽车制造等多个行业。它基于 ANSYS 的技术架构,提供了一套完
starccm运行进程名称是什么
星际流体动力学模拟器:StarCCM+ 的运行进程名称揭秘
在工程仿真领域,StarCCM+ 是一款备受推崇的流体动力学模拟软件,广泛应用于航空航天、能源、汽车制造等多个行业。它基于 ANSYS 的技术架构,提供了一套完整的流体动力学分析工具。对于用户来说,了解 StarCCM+ 的运行进程名称 是一个关键的入门点,它不仅有助于理解软件的工作原理,还能帮助用户在调试和优化仿真过程中更好地定位问题。
StarCCM+ 的运行进程名称是 StarCCM+,它是一个 独立的进程,在系统中运行时,通常会以 StarCCM+ 作为进程名进行标识。这是软件设计中的一种标准做法,确保在系统日志、监控工具或任务管理器中能够清晰地识别出该进程的存在。在 Windows 系统中,可以通过任务管理器查看进程列表,找到 StarCCM+ 进程并对其进行管理,例如终止、监控或日志收集。
StarCCM+ 的运行机制与进程结构
StarCCM+ 的运行机制基于 多线程架构,它能够高效地处理大规模的流体动力学仿真任务。其进程结构主要包括以下几个核心组件:
1. 主进程(Main Process):这是 StarCCM+ 的主控进程,负责协调整个仿真任务的执行。它负责初始化仿真环境、加载模型、分配计算资源,并控制整个仿真流程。
2. 计算进程(Compute Process):计算进程负责执行具体的仿真计算任务,包括求解流体动力学方程、进行网格划分、执行求解器迭代等。它通常以 StarCCM+ Compute 作为进程名运行。
3. 网格生成进程(Mesh Generation Process):网格生成进程负责将三维模型划分成网格,生成网格文件。它通常以 StarCCM+ Mesh 作为进程名运行。
4. 求解器进程(Solver Process):求解器进程负责执行流体动力学方程的求解,包括压力、速度、温度等物理量的计算。它通常以 StarCCM+ Solver 作为进程名运行。
5. 后处理进程(Post-Processing Process):后处理进程负责对仿真结果进行可视化和分析,例如生成图表、进行数据统计、生成报告等。它通常以 StarCCM+ Post-Process 作为进程名运行。
StarCCM+ 的进程结构设计非常灵活,可以根据实际需求进行进程的划分和组合。例如,用户可以将主进程与计算进程分离,以实现并行计算,提高仿真效率。同时,StarCCM+ 支持多种进程调度方式,包括单进程、多进程、集群计算等。
StarCCM+ 的运行环境与进程管理
StarCCM+ 的运行环境通常包括以下几个关键组件:
1. 操作系统:StarCCM+ 主要支持 Windows 和 Linux 系统,其中 Windows 是最常用的平台。在 Windows 系统中,StarCCM+ 通常以 StarCCM+ 作为进程名运行。
2. 仿真环境:StarCCM+ 通常运行在仿真环境中,例如 ANSYS WorkbenchANSYS Cloud。在这些环境中,StarCCM+ 作为独立的进程运行,与其他仿真工具协同工作。
3. 任务管理器:在 Windows 系统中,用户可以通过 任务管理器 查看 StarCCM+ 进程的运行状态。在任务管理器中,用户可以查看进程的 CPU 使用率、内存占用、磁盘使用情况等信息,从而判断仿真任务是否正常进行。
4. 日志文件:StarCCM+ 会在运行过程中生成日志文件,记录仿真过程中的关键信息。这些日志文件通常以 StarCCM+ 作为文件名,用于调试和分析问题。用户可以通过查看日志文件,了解仿真任务是否出现异常,例如计算中断、内存溢出等。
5. 监控工具:StarCCM+ 提供了一些监控工具,帮助用户实时跟踪仿真进程的状态。例如,StarCCM+ Monitor 是一个用于监控仿真进程的工具,可以显示进程的运行状态、资源使用情况等信息。
StarCCM+ 的运行环境和进程管理设计非常灵活,用户可以根据实际需求进行配置和调整,以满足不同的仿真需求。
StarCCM+ 的运行性能与进程优化
StarCCM+ 的运行性能是其广泛应用的重要保障,尤其是在复杂流体动力学仿真中,性能的稳定性和高效性直接影响到仿真结果的准确性。为了确保仿真任务的高效运行,StarCCM+ 提供了多种进程优化策略,包括:
1. 多线程计算:StarCCM+ 支持多线程计算,能够将计算任务分配到多个线程上并行执行。这不仅可以提高计算效率,还能减少仿真时间,提高仿真任务的完成速度。
2. 资源分配优化:StarCCM+ 提供了资源分配优化功能,可以根据仿真任务的需要动态调整 CPU、内存、磁盘等资源的使用。这有助于提高仿真任务的运行效率,避免资源浪费。
3. 进程隔离与并行计算:StarCCM+ 支持进程隔离和并行计算,用户可以将不同的仿真任务分配到不同的进程中运行,从而提高整体仿真效率。
4. 仿真任务调度:StarCCM+ 提供了任务调度功能,可以根据仿真任务的需要动态调整任务的执行顺序,优化仿真过程的运行效率。
5. 资源监控与调优:StarCCM+ 提供了资源监控功能,用户可以实时跟踪仿真任务的资源使用情况,并根据需要进行调优,确保仿真任务的高效运行。
StarCCM+ 的运行性能和进程优化策略,使得它能够在复杂的流体动力学仿真中保持高效、稳定和可靠的工作状态。
StarCCM+ 的运行特点与用户交互
StarCCM+ 的运行特点决定了其在工程仿真中的广泛应用,同时,它也提供了丰富的用户交互功能,帮助用户更好地进行仿真任务的管理和执行。
1. 用户界面:StarCCM+ 提供了丰富的用户界面,包括模型编辑器、求解器设置、网格划分工具、后处理工具等。用户可以通过图形界面进行模型的创建、网格的划分、求解器的设置和结果的分析,从而提高仿真任务的执行效率。
2. 脚本与命令行:StarCCM+ 支持脚本和命令行操作,用户可以通过编写脚本或使用命令行工具进行仿真任务的自动化执行。这不仅提高了仿真任务的效率,还降低了用户的学习成本。
3. 插件与扩展:StarCCM+ 提供了丰富的插件和扩展功能,用户可以根据需要安装和使用各种插件,以扩展仿真功能。例如,用户可以安装插件以支持特定的仿真模型或求解器。
4. 数据管理与共享:StarCCM+ 支持数据管理与共享功能,用户可以将仿真结果保存为文件,并与他人共享。这有助于团队协作,提高仿真任务的执行效率。
5. 调试与测试:StarCCM+ 提供了调试与测试功能,用户可以对仿真任务进行调试,检查计算结果是否符合预期。这有助于提高仿真任务的准确性和可靠性。
StarCCM+ 的运行特点和用户交互功能,使得它在工程仿真领域具有广泛的应用前景。
StarCCM+ 的运行应用与行业影响
StarCCM+ 的运行应用不仅限于流体动力学仿真,它还广泛应用于多个工程领域,包括:
1. 航空航天:StarCCM+ 在航空航天领域被广泛用于气动设计、流体力学分析和气动外形优化。例如,用于模拟飞机机翼的气动性能,优化机翼的形状,以提高飞行效率和燃油经济性。
2. 能源:StarCCM+ 在能源领域被用于风力发电机的设计和优化,模拟风力涡轮机的气动性能,提高风能转换效率。此外,StarCCM+ 也被用于研究燃气轮机的气动性能,提高燃烧效率。
3. 汽车制造:StarCCM+ 在汽车制造领域被用于汽车外形设计、气动性能分析和空气动力学优化。例如,用于模拟汽车的空气动力学性能,优化车身设计,提高车辆的燃油经济性和稳定性。
4. 化工与材料科学:StarCCM+ 在化工与材料科学领域被用于流体流动模拟、传质与传热分析,提高化工反应器的设计效率和材料性能分析的准确性。
5. 生物医学:StarCCM+ 在生物医学领域被用于血液流动模拟、器官功能分析和生物流体动力学研究,提高医疗设备的设计效率和生物医学研究的准确性。
StarCCM+ 的运行应用广泛,它在多个工程领域中发挥着重要作用,为工程仿真提供了强大的技术支持。
StarCCM+ 的运行挑战与未来展望
尽管 StarCCM+ 在工程仿真领域表现出色,但它也面临一些运行挑战,包括:
1. 计算资源需求高:StarCCM+ 在处理大规模流体动力学仿真时,通常需要较多的计算资源,包括 CPU、内存和存储。这可能导致计算成本较高,尤其是在处理复杂模型时。
2. 仿真时间较长:StarCCM+ 在执行复杂仿真任务时,计算时间通常较长。这可能导致仿真任务的执行时间较长,影响用户的使用体验。
3. 用户学习曲线较高:StarCCM+ 的使用需要一定的专业知识和技能,用户需要学习模型创建、网格划分、求解器设置等技能,这可能对初学者构成一定的挑战。
4. 多平台兼容性有限:StarCCM+ 主要支持 Windows 和 Linux 系统,但在某些平台上可能存在兼容性问题,影响用户的使用体验。
未来,StarCCM+ 的发展将聚焦于以下几个方面:
1. 提升计算性能:StarCCM+ 将继续优化计算性能,提升多线程计算能力和并行计算效率,以提高仿真任务的执行速度。
2. 降低运行成本:StarCCM+ 将优化资源分配策略,降低计算资源的使用成本,提高仿真任务的经济性。
3. 简化用户操作:StarCCM+ 将继续优化用户界面,提高用户操作的便捷性,降低学习曲线,提高用户的使用体验。
4. 增强平台兼容性:StarCCM+ 将继续增强多平台兼容性,支持更多操作系统和硬件平台,提高用户的使用灵活性。
StarCCM+ 的未来发展将不断推动工程仿真技术的进步,为工程领域提供更强大的技术支持。
总结与展望
StarCCM+ 是一款在工程仿真领域具有广泛应用的流体动力学模拟软件,其运行进程名称为 StarCCM+,并由多个核心进程协同工作,确保仿真任务的高效执行。StarCCM+ 的运行机制和进程结构设计灵活,能够适应多种仿真需求,同时,其运行环境和进程管理功能为用户提供了便捷的使用体验。
StarCCM+ 的运行特点和用户交互功能,使得它在多个工程领域中发挥着重要作用。尽管其运行面临一定的挑战,但未来的发展将不断优化计算性能、降低运行成本、简化用户操作,并增强平台兼容性,以更好地满足工程仿真需求。
StarCCM+ 的运行不仅为工程仿真提供了强大的技术支持,也为用户在实际工程应用中提供了可靠、高效的仿真解决方案。随着技术的不断进步,StarCCM+ 将继续发挥其重要作用,推动工程仿真技术的发展。